The triaxial accelerometer Type 8794A... measures shock and vibration in three mutually perpendicular axes. Their quartz sensing elements are contained in a unique flat package and housed in a welded, stainless steel case with the integral cable epoxy sealed to the case. Kistler’s K-Shear design provides a wide operating frequency range along with extremely low sensitivity to thermal transients and transverse acceleration. Quartz sensing elements ensure long-term stability and are superior to other sensing materials.
Each of the three sensing elements is internally connected to a Piezotron® microelectronic circuit that converts the charge signal from the quartz piezoelectric elements into a useable high level voltage signal at a low impedance output allowing the use of a low-cost cable. Cable wires are soldered to terminals outside the case and covered by a epoxy molded strain relief cover. This electrical connection provides the advantages of an integral cable but permits replacement of damaged output wires.
